Notes on some Marchantiales taxa from Rishiri Island, Japan

Rishiri Island is located near the northernmost coast of Japan, and is of great botanical interest due to the presence of a high-altitude stratovolcano. Through our recent expeditions to this island, we provided notes on some noteworthy Marchantiales taxa. We speculated that human activities and climate changes may cause the decline or disappearance of the populations of the alpine species, such as Peltolepis quadrata, Mannia gracilis and Sauteria alpina, and allow the introduction of some species that prefer low-lying and/or man-made habitats. Since there are few reports on Japanese materials, we gave a detailed illustration of Peltolepis quadrata on its important distinguishing characters. Marchantia polymorpha L. subsp. polymorpha is reported as new to Hokkaido. The distribution and taxonomic status of Cleveaceae taxa in Japan requires further reevaluation.
